Odisha Junior Engineer Arrested for Accepting Bribe: What Happened?

Bribery Incident in Bargarh District
Bhubaneswar: A junior engineer was apprehended for allegedly accepting a bribe of Rs 8,000 from a contractor in Bargarh district, Odisha, on Tuesday, according to a vigilance official.
The female junior engineer had recently started her career with the district rural development agency (DRDA) in Gaisilet block, having joined in January 2024. This marked her first assignment in government service.
She was caught red-handed while demanding and receiving Rs 8,000 from the contractor, which was part of her total bribe demand of Rs 32,000 for processing pending bills related to road improvement work under the MGNREGA scheme.
The total estimated cost for the project stands at Rs 9.50 lakh, with Rs 3.15 lakh already disbursed in previous payments.
According to the official, the junior engineer was requesting a bribe amounting to 10% of the paid bill to facilitate the clearance of outstanding bills. Previously, she had already accepted Rs 24,000 and was now seeking the remaining Rs 8,000.
All the bribe money has been confiscated from her possession.
In the wake of this incident, simultaneous searches are being conducted at two locations associated with the junior engineer.
A case has been filed at the Sambalpur vigilance police station under the Prevention of Corruption (Amendment) Act, 2018, and investigations are ongoing.
